Burger King accelerates release of $5 value meal to outdo upcoming McDonald’s deal

USA TODAY – Fast food giants like McDonald’s and Wendy’s are racing to win customers back with cheap deals after skyrocketing prices turned consumers away.

Enter Burger King, one of Ronald McDonald’s biggest competitors.

According to an internal memo reviewed by Bloomberg, BK has plans in motion not only to launch its own $5 meal deal but to do so before the McDonald’s campaign, which is reportedly set for late June.

“Burger King is accelerating its value offers after three quarters of leading the industry in value traffic. We are bringing back our $5 Your Way Meal as agreed upon with our franchisees back in April,” Burger King said in a statement to USA TODAY.

The Burger King deal, called the $5 Your Way Meal, will include a choice between three sandwiches in addition to chicken nuggets, fries and a drink.

The value meal is also slated to stick around for “several months,” versus four weeks at McDonald’s, Burger King confirmed in an email to USA TODAY.

“Regardless of their plans, we are moving full speed ahead with our own plans to launch our own $5 value meal before they do − and run it for several months,” said the memo …
